Jack J. Ading (born 1 September 1960{{cite web |title=Jack J. Ading|url=https://rmiparliament.org/cms/members.html#8-minister-of-justice-honorbale-jack-j-ading |website=rmiparliament.org |publisher=Nitijela |access-date=20 October 2022}} is a Marshallese politician who served as a member of the cabinet, and as a member of Nitijela.
He has a degree in accounting from Hawaii Pacific University.{{cite web |title=Jack J. Ading |url=https://rmiparliament.org/cms/members.html#23-senator-honorable-jack-j-ading |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20170116160700/https://rmiparliament.org/cms/members.html#23-senator-honorable-jack-j-ading |archive-date=2017-01-16 |publisher=Nitijela |access-date=16 January 2017 |date=16 January 2017}}
He worked as an accountant from 1981 to 2006. Since 2007 he has been elected as senator for the constituency of Enewetak and Ujelang Atoll in Nitijela. Ading was the Minister of Finance of the Marshall Islands from 2008 to 2012, and from 2014 to 2016.
He served as the Minister of Justice from 2018{{cite web |title=Mike out, Jack in |url=https://marshallislandsjournal.com/mike-out-jack-in/ |website=The Marshall Islands Journal |language=en-AU |date=28 June 2018}} to 2020 and was reappointed in 2022.{{cite web |title=New Cabinet members sworn in |url=https://marshallislandsjournal.com/new-cabinet-members-sworn-in/ |website=The Marshall Islands Journal |access-date=22 June 2022 |language=en-AU |date=8 June 2022}}
